Heworth property market: common questions
Where is Heworth?
Heworth is in central York, in North Yorkshire. Figures for Heworth cover listings within about 1 km of its centre (the dashed ring on the map), not an official boundary.
What is the average house price in Heworth?
The median asking price across the 101 homes for sale in Heworth is £290,000 (as of 20 August 2026). We quote the median (the middle listing) rather than a mean, because a handful of very expensive homes would pull a mean upwards. Half of listings ask between £235,000 and £400,000. That is 3% below York. Homes that actually sold in Heworth went for a median £280,000 (Land Registry, 12 months to December 2025).
How many homes are for sale in Heworth?
101 homes are on the market in Heworth right now, 35 of them listed in the last 30 days. Perch counts every listing it tracks across estate agents and portals, refreshed daily.
Are house prices being cut in Heworth?
11 listings in Heworth had their asking price reduced in the last 30 days, about 11% of the homes currently for sale.
How much do flats and houses cost in Heworth?
The median asking price for a flat in Heworth is £210,000; for a house it is £280,000. Use the property type and bedroom filters on this page for a finer cut.
What is the price per square foot in Heworth?
In Heworth, homes that sold went for a median £334 per sq ft (HM Land Registry and EPC data), and current listings with a known floor area ask a median £345 per sq ft.
How these numbers are made
- Asking figures: Current listings we track across estate agents and portals (101 in Heworth), refreshed daily, as of 20 August 2026. We quote medians, never means, and suppress anything based on fewer than 5 listings. Figures for Heworth cover listings within about 1 km of its centre (the dashed ring on the map), not an official boundary.
- Off market and time listed: Off-market counts include only listings confirmed off the market after a short grace period; "typical time listed" is time advertised, not time to sell. We have tracked Heworth since March 2026.
- York comparisons: The same daily snapshot taken across the whole of York, so both sides of every comparison share one basis. Where a comparison spans all property types, some of the gap reflects what is for sale here.
- Sold figures: HM Land Registry price paid data for the 12 months to December 2025 (the latest months are left out while sales are still being registered), with floor areas from EPC certificates. England and Wales; new-builds and non-standard transactions excluded.
